The ICC Men's T20 World Cup 2026 is approaching its decisive phase as Afghanistan face Canada in the penultimate group-stage fixture at MA Chidambaram Stadium in Chennai on Wednesday, February 19. Afghanistan are already out of contention for the Super Eights but still have pride to play for after a challenging campaign. Led by Rashid Khan, they suffered narrow defeats to South Africa and New Zealand, results that ultimately ended their hopes of progressing further in the tournament.

Canada, meanwhile, have struggled to find rhythm throughout the competition and are also searching for a consolation victory. Their campaign began with a heavy loss and soon spiraled into three straight defeats, including setbacks against United Arab Emirates and New Zealand. Under captain Dilpreet Bajwa, the side has shown glimpses of promise but lacked consistency in key moments. With elimination already confirmed, they will be determined to finish their World Cup journey on a positive note rather than return home without a win.
